Miatel Consulting Sl Salary

As of July 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Miatel Consulting Sl in the United States is $93,824.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$45. Salaries at Miatel Consulting Sl typically range from $82,637 to $105,867 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Miatel Consulting Sl
Miatel Consulting Sl is a company that operates in the Telecommunications industry. It employs 11-20 people and has $1M-$5M of revenue. The company is headquartered in Boadilla del Monte, Spain.
